†SCHOOLADGE, n. School fees. Sometimes in comb. schooladge fies, id.Bnff. 1718 W. Cramond Ann. Bnff. (S.C.) II. 182:
Alloweing to him the sallaries, fees and emoluments to the said office belonging with the schooladge fies, used and wount.
